I use this script to gather tapes for DR testing. I think this is what you
want:


Name           Line       Command

               Number
----------     ------
------------------------------------------------------------
BRSLIST        1          select volume_name,status from volumes where
volume_name in
                           (select volume_name from volumeusage where

                           node_name='$1'and stgpool_name='$2') order by

                           status,volume_name


Name                Description
Managing profile
---------------     --------------------------------------------------
--------------------
BRSLIST             Usage: RUN BRSLIST SERVERNAME STGPOOLNAME i.e.

                     'Run brslist FS010 COPYVAULT' - Server and

                     stgpool must be UPPER CASE.
